Doctor of Nursing Practice | Dual Board-Certified Nurse Practitioner
Jenna Taylor is a doctorally prepared nurse practitioner based in Oklahoma City with extensive clinical training across the nursing spectrum. She holds dual board certifications from both the American Association of Nurse Practitioners (AANP) and the American Nurses Credentialing Center (ANCC), reflecting a high standard of versatile, evidence-based care.
Jenna’s academic background is marked by advanced specialization. She earned her Master of Science in Nursing with a focus on Family Practice from The University of Oklahoma Health Sciences Center, followed by a Post-Master’s Certificate in Adult-Gerontology Acute Care from Oklahoma City University. She culminated her formal education by returning to the OU Health Sciences Center to complete her Post-Master’s Doctorate of Nursing Practice (DNP).
